Mount Snow Ski Vacations By: David Riewe Mount Snow, located in Vermont, is the one of the largest ski resorts in the Eastern United States. Featuring 26 lifts and more than 135 trails, the top elevation at Mount Snow is 3600 feet, with a vertical drop of 1700 feet. There are 20 chair lifts and six surface lifts available.

Les Menuires: Ski Access For Less By: Roberto Bell If you've ever heard of the Trois Vallees (Three Valleys) close to the Vanoise National park in France, then you already know the greatness surrounding the Les Menuires ski resort. Located up from the Belleville Valley of Savoie, Les Menuires is far less expensive for families than the other resorts. Together with the Val Thorens, Meribel and Courchevel resorts, you'll have all the valuable amenities on the cheap, right at your doorstep. Courmayeur, Italy: Ski & Soiree In One By: Jonathan Swift At the bottom of Mont Blanc, lying on the Italian side of the mountain, you'll find the Italian ski resort of Courmayeur. Near the Aosta Valley-the least populated region in Italy-Courmayeur fits the Italian village image. Small restaurants with tables in the alleyways and cobbler's cobblestones forming the passageways, Courmayeur is a postcard of medieval Europe.
